What is duct cleaning service?

Duct cleaning service is the process of removing dust, debris, and other contaminants from the interior of your home's HVAC ductwork. Our technicians use specialized tools to clean the inside of your ducts, improving the air you breathe.

How often do house air ducts need to be cleaned?

In Massachusetts, with its varied seasons, it's generally recommended to have your air ducts cleaned every 3-5 years. This helps manage the buildup of allergens and dust that can occur throughout the year, especially after periods of heavy HVAC use.

What is included in duct cleaning?

Our service includes the thorough cleaning of your HVAC system's supply and return air ducts. We also clean vital components like the blower motor, fan blades, and air handler to ensure comprehensive debris removal.
